Italian Balsamic Vinegar is about balance — origin, time, and the harmony between acidity and viscosity.

The word “balsamic” comes from the Italian balsamico, meaning warmth and harmony.
It doesn’t describe sharpness or acidity, but a gentle, rounded character that brings a dish together.

True Italian balsamic vinegar is made from grape must, slowly fermented and aged in wooden barrels. Its acidity is clear but never harsh, while its viscosity comes naturally from time — never from additives.

In Italy, balsamic vinegar is protected by law — IGP for everyday balance and versatility, DOP for traditionally aged expressions, used sparingly, drop by drop.

That is why not every dark vinegar can be called balsamic. When acidity and viscosity find their balance, balsamic becomes more than a seasoning — it is time and craftsmanship meeting at the table.

Have you tried an EVOOs that carries a soft violet note 🌸 — light, floral, and very natural?

If “violet” doesn’t resonate, think fresh flowers or a gentle floral lift, not sweetness. These oils are often made from early-harvest olives, handled gently, and tend to be richer in polyphenols.

That freshness shows best with simple, clean food: burrata or fresh cheeses, white fish or scallops, spring vegetables — even fruit like strawberries or citrus.

Delicate in flavour, but quietly good.

Bold in colour, unmistakable in character.
Black Truffle Sauce (with 5% summer truffle) is one of the flagship expressions of the range.

Its deep black hue comes from cuttlefish ink, delivering a striking visual and pungent, savoury depth layered with earthy truffle notes.

How to enjoy & cook:
• Toss warm edamame with a small spoon of truffle sauce, olive oil and flaky sea salt — an effortless appetiser
• Spread on toast or croutons
• Stir into pasta, risotto or polenta
• Use as filling for ravioli, tortelli or meat
• Pair with grilled, roasted or fried meats
• Finish roasted or pan-fried vegetables (especially potatoes, artichokes and aubergines)
• Fold into omelettes or eggs
• Add to pizza just before serving
• Spoon over baked fish
